Mundelein extended their winning streak  to three  on Thursday, bumping their season record up to 22-10 in the process. They came within a single  run of losing the streak, but they secured  a   1-0 W against the Stevenson Patriots. Surprisingly, this marked the Mustangs' third straight game in which the away team has come away the victor.
 Stevenson's batters probably weren't too happy with  Sophia Zepeda, who pitched a no hitter  and racked up eight Ks (she gave up six walks). Zepeda has been consistent recently: she hasn't  given up  more than one  earned run in four consecutive appearances.
As for Stevenson, their loss  ended  a  12-game streak of wins at home  and  dropped them to 28-4. Having soared to a lofty ten  runs in the game before, their shutout was a dramatic turnaround.
 On Stevenson's side,  Ava Potempa sp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ered only one earned run on one hit and racked up seven Ks.
Mundelein will have a chance to go back-to-back against the Patriots: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led  at 11:00  a.m.  on Saturday.
